I am concerned about supervisors who think that a single rubric can be used for every assignment and shared by several instructors. I am willing to agree to some conformity, but as this course points out, one purpose of a rubric s to give students information about expectations for performance and feedback as to how well those expectations are met.

Sarah,

One rubric can't evaluate everything. They have to be connected to learning objectives. One for all is not realistic. Thanks!
